38% increase in revenue from operations in Q3 FY22 on a y-o-y basis and 14% growth on a sequential basis for Latent view | Q3 FY22 Conference Call

2 min read
  • Sales rose 37.70% to Rs 107.75 crore in the quarter ended December 2021 as against Rs 78.25 crore during the previous quarter ended December 2020. Net profit rose 122.41% to Rs 49.93 crore in the quarter ended December 2021 as against Rs 22.45 crore during the previous quarter ended December 2020. Net profit doubled because of exceptional item of Rs 22 crore pertaining to an amount received from the US government for a pay-check protection program connected to Covid-19 relief.
  • Operating profit margin is 30.5%.
  • Attrition: In FY21 (20-22%), Q1 and Q2 of FY22 it is 30%+ while in Q3 it has dropped slightly.
  • Revenue per employee is high for the company because it operates in the high end of the value chain of data analytics.
  • Managed services consist of 75% of the companies’ revenues while Time and material consists of 25%. Company prefers managed services mode of the revenue generation because it imparts more flexibility to management in terms of staffing and ramping up as well as periodic generation of revenues on monthly or quarterly basis.
  • Vertical Revenue mix: Technology (67%), CPG (15%) and Others (18%).
  • Onsite to offshore mix ranges from 1: 3.3 to 1: 5.5.
  • Consulting and diagnostics (10-15%), Data engineering and services (25-30%), Business analytics and insights (60%) of the revenues.
  • Company has taken two salary hikes in April and Oct-21. 30% of the employees are granted employee stock ownership plan (esops) by the company.
  • USA contributes 95% of the revenues followed by Europe (3%) and rest of the world (2%).
  • Top 20 clients contribute 90% of the revenues while top 5 contributes 61%.
